Nokia 7100s in Europe

By Tony - 10/16/2008 1:06:41 PM



Nokia has announced a new cellphone that will make its debut in the European market in the near future, the 7100s. The slipping cellphone is on the S40 category (Series 40) and the expected price is close to $280.

At the moment there aren’t many exact details, but from the image we can understand this is an entry-level phone.

In terms of features, the Nokia 7100s has a QVGA display screen with 260k colors, a 1.3-megapixel camera to shoot photos, and an audio + video player. To transfer files from/to a computer you’ve got two options: a microUSB connector, or bluetooth 2.0.

Other features include 3G support, tri-band GSM, and Opera Mini as the pre-loaded browser.
